TUTOR TROUBLE

Throughout Chemistry class, I swear I could feel Tyler’s gaze on me. It was unfortunate we shared a classroom; what was more unfortunate was the magazine he had seen in my backpack.

He’d obviously suspect I wasn’t into girls. Maybe it was a good thing…he’d probably stop taunting and humiliating me or accusing me of stealing his girlfriend.

After class, I snuck out through a back door close to the cafeteria, avoiding Tyler and his gang. I had discovered that door last week. It was the safest spot for me to escape them without being humiliated.

The bus stopped in front of the house, and I took a deep breath. Finally, I was free from all that drama. I scurried towards the house, and as I entered, Mum was already home early. I beamed with joy at the thought of lunch; my mum was a very good chef.

“Cariño, you have a visitor,” she said warmly. I looked over to see Eleanor forcing a smile on the couch, still in the clothes she wore to school…she hadn’t even reached home.

“Com estas, Asher?” she said timidly. I rolled my eyes.

“Yh, hi Eleanor… It’s a surprise you’re here,” I feigned a smile.

“She said she wanted to thank you. She got an A in Español and a B in Calculus…very impressive, isn’t that right, Asher?” Mum responded, and my eyes widened.

“That’s great,” I responded, feeling a little proud I was her tutor.

“Let’s get some juice and grilled chicken to celebrate,” Mum said, dashing into the kitchen, beaming. Mum really liked Eleanor; in fact, she liked every girl I brought home…like Lily, my study buddy from my previous school, then Flora and Eleanor. Sometimes I feel like she secretly wants me to fornicate. I turned towards Eleanor with a grim look on my face.

“Why are you here?” I asked, and she dropped her head in silence for a while before responding.

“Asher, I’m so sorry about what’s happening between you and Tyler…”

“And you know it’s all your fault, right? Why can’t you just leave me alone!!!” I stressed. Then she dropped a bomb.

“I’m leaving Tyler.”

“What!” I thundered. “You’re just making things worse!”

“But I love you, Asher…”

“I don’t reciprocate, Eleanor. I don’t love you,” I stressed. “I don’t want to be your tutor anymore.”

Her face fell hearing my words. Mum walked in with a tray of quesadillas. Dropping the tray on the dining table, she signaled us to come.

We sat quietly at the dining table and began eating. Mum noticed the awkwardness around; I could tell from her shifting gaze.

After lunch, I escorted Eleanor out to catch a bus back home. I got back and jumped on my bed, staring at the ceiling… I remembered how close Tyler’s mouth had been to my face, and I scowled… his hot breath and strong masculine perfume… I could still feel and smell them.

Why was I even thinking about that pompous d*ck? Just then a mail popped up on my phone, and as I opened it, my chest soared as it read:

“Congratulations Mr. Asher Miguel, Oakdale High has emerged first place in the Harvard Grand Quiz Competition……”

I paused in excitement, unable to complete the text. Just then, Mum, accompanied by Dad, rushed in squealing in excitement.

“Cariño, your principal just called…” she said in excitement.

“I just got a mail from Harvard, Mum, we won!” I yelled in excitement, almost bawling my eyes out. Dad wore a proud look on his face.

“All thanks to the Lord,” he stated warmly. “Let us thank God for this great accomplishment,” he added, kneeling beside my bed, and we followed as he began singing Thankful by Kelly Clarkson.

Our winning meant my tuition for senior year was covered, and our basketball team had a slot in an annual league hosted by Harvard…. I snickered silently as I thought: I wonder how Tyler would feel about this.
